Notes - Joseph and Catherine had sixteen children. Joseph built a home near Metamora, and was known as the best and richest farmer in Woodford County. They became part of the Apostolic Christian Church, and Joseph, Catherine and Elizabeth are buried in the AC cemetery at Roanoke. [4]
